## Deployment Note: Session-Token Refresh Fix

Release 4.2 of Lanternbox patches a bug where expired session tokens were refreshed without re-validating the device fingerprint, allowing a stale token to be extended indefinitely. The fix enforces a hard ceiling on refresh count and rebinds each refresh to the fingerprint hash. Reviewers should confirm the ceiling is enforced server-side, not in the client SDK. The relevant hardening settings are shown in the configuration block below.

config for bagep-kageg:
ULADOR_LOG_LEVEL=warn
ULADOR_METRICS_HOST=metrics.ulador.tolvaqcorp.corp
ULADOR_POOL_SIZE=32

## Who to ping about GiftNote

Welcome aboard! GiftNote is our donation-receipt mailer for the Larchfield Fund. Template tweaks go to the comms folks; delivery failures and bounce weirdness go to the platform crew. Don't push template changes on Fridays — receipts batch over the weekend. For anything GiftNote-related, start with the address below.

billing contact of kaweg-tajeg = drudor.lamion.oliath@torvalabs.test

## Ingest path

The Furrowlink gateway sits between in-field telemetry units and the Harvestline backend. Tractors and combines report over a patchy rural LTE link, so the gateway buffers readings locally and forwards them in batches when connectivity allows. New team members should note that batching is deliberate: per-reading uploads would drain unit batteries and overwhelm the intake API during morning startup surges. Batch size, flush interval, and retry behavior are governed by the constants listed below.

limits module of tawep-hawif:
WEIGHTS = {
    "sordor": 228,
    "kasax": 458,
    "ulaox": 8,
    "casix": 495,
    "briix": 335,
}